Ir al contenido principal

Operador condicional en JavaScript

JavaScript contiene un operador condicional que asigna un valor a una variable a partir de una condición.

Su sintaxis es la siguiente:

variable=(condicion)?valor1:valor2

Si la condicion es verdadera la variable toma el valor1 sino toma el valor2. Es como el condicional if else.

Ejemplo:


<!DOCTYPE html>
<html>
<body>

Edad:<input type="text" id="caja" />

<button onclick="myFunction()">OK</button>

<p id="demo"></p>

<script>
function myFunction()
{
var edad,resultado;
edad=document.getElementById("caja").value;
resultado=(edad<18)?"Eres menor de edad":"Eres mayor de edad";
document.getElementById("demo").innerHTML=resultado;
}
</script>

</body>
</html>


En el ejemplo se crea una caja de texto en el cual se ingresa una edad. Capturamos el valor que digiten y creamos la siguiente condicion: (edad<18) si la edad ingresada es menor a 18 la variable resultado toma el valor: "Eres menor de edad" sino "Eres mayor de edad".

Edad:




Comentarios

Entradas más populares de este blog

Buscador en tiempo real con AJAX, PHP y MySQL

Buscador realizado en HTML utilizando como lenguaje de programación PHP , la tecnología AJAX y a MySQL como motor de base de datos.

Funciones (subprocesos) en PSeInt

A partir de la version 20121010 (10/Octubre/2012) PSeInt permite la posibilidad de definir funciones al que el creador del mismo bautizó como subprocesos , en este tutorial explicaremos brevemente cómo se tratan dichas funciones. Para empezar una función no es más que un bloque de código con un determinado fin o propósito, podemos definir más de una y nos permiten ahorrar líneas código si nuestros programas son muy extensos o hay codificación redundante.

Convertir un decimal a binario en PSeInt

Utilizaremos el siguiente método para convertir números decimales a binarios (números que se sólo se componen de unos y ceros). El método es sencillo, consiste en dividir el número decimal entre dos, despues su cociente entre el mismo número y así sucesivamente hasta que finalmente el cociente (que se convierte en un divisor) sea igual a uno. Despúes organizamos los residuos desde el último al primero para obtener el número binario que buscamos.